Horrible horrible team

Its not so much the threat of scoring from throw ins that annoys people. Its the time wasting and breaking up of play.

Its a case of force ball out of play
Wait for Delap to run and get it
Delap waits for towel
Delap fannies about drying ball
Delap waits for all stoke players to croud the box
Delap eventually takes throw in

I remember a stat from around xmas time. They had 400 more throw ins than any other team in the league.

Its more like watching a American football/Rugby game watching them play.
